Roles & Responsibilities
- Assist surgical team during Labor & Delivery and Cesarean procedures, ensuring patient safety and sterile technique
- Prepare and maintain the operating room, instruments, and specialized equipment (Triton, Neptune, Cysto Tower)
- Perform specimen handling and labeling with precision to support accurate diagnostics
- Follow Universal Protocol (time-out) and aseptic technique for every case
- Anticipate surgeon needs, pass instruments efficiently, and manage case flow to reduce OR time
- Support emergency management and maintain crash cart readiness when needed
- Communicate clearly with nursing, anesthesia, and surgical colleagues to deliver seamless patient care
- Participate in unit-specific tasks such as tubal ligations, cerclage, D&C, and occasional hysterectomy cases
